The characteristics of offspring are not determined by the parents' phenotypes, but by their genotypes. The genes for hair color that a parent caries are not immediately apparent by the parent's own hair color. Only genetic testing will reveal what inactive genes the parent may have. A parent with brown hair may have recessive genes for blond, black, or red hair, or maybe a total dominance of brown-hair genes. If both parents have homozygous brown hair, the offspring will have brown hair. It is more likely, however, that the code for brown hair is heterozygous, in which case the color of the offspring's hair is essentially impossible to determine without DNA testing.

Blue eyes are recessive to brown eyes. So if the mother is heterozygous for brown eyes then it is possible for the child to have blue eyes. However if the mother is homozygous for brown eyes than the child will have brown eyes. Since both parents are brunettes, the child will definitely have brown hair as well.
